Zoom R20 Multitrack Digital Recorder

This standalone recorder has it all: a 4.3" touchscreen, 8 mic preamps, 16 tracks, onboard editing, effects, drum loops, MIDI synths, and an 8x4 interface.

With a familiar touchscreen interface, the Zoom R20 multi-track recorder makes it insanely simple to track, edit and mix your songs, letting you focus on the music.

The R20 has the best preamps and noise floor of any multi track recorder Zoom has ever designed. With six XLR inputs, two combo inputs, and 16 tracks of recording, the R20 is perfect for singer-songwriters to full bands.

Drag. Drop. Pinch. Swipe. Create.

Navigate and edit with ease, via the R20's 4.3-inch color LCD touchscreen interface.

Color-Coded for Clarity

Improve your workflow with color-coded faders, gain dials, and touchscreen track regions, making sure you are always adjusting the correct channel.

Put the Pieces Together

Cut, copy, combine and loop. The R20's interface provides intuitive editing. You'll immediately feel at home.

Spice Things Up

Polish your tracks and mixes with professional effects such as EQ, compression, and more. The R20 provides a full MFX processor compatible with Guitar Lab software.

The Rhythm is Gonna Get You

30 genres, 150 rhythm patterns and song form variations, it's hard to find a drummer this versatile.

18 Built-in Synth Sounds

Plug in a MIDI keyboard via USB-C or use the touchscreen to add sonic textures with the R20's internal synthesizer.

Backing Tracks

The R20 can import and playback standard MIDI files allowing you to import bass lines, melodies, piano parts, and more.

Record to SD

The R20 records directly to SDHC or SDXC cards read more up to 1TB, giving you plenty of space to track your next song or album.

Monitor and Playback

The R20 has a headphone jack for monitoring while recording and dedicated outputs for mixing on your favorite monitors.

Locking AC Adapter: The Zoom locking adapter ensures security against accidental unplugging.

Click: Access the fully adjustable click track with just a press of a button.

Inputs: Hi-Z is available on input 1, while 48V phantom power is available on input 5-8.

Wireless Control App: Use the optional Zoom BTA-1 Bluetooth Adapter, available separately, to control the R20 wirelessly from your iOS device.

Accessibility for the Visually Impaired: The first multi-track recorder that allows accessibility for the visually impaired, the R20 app features VoiceOver and VoiceOver Gestures.

Features:

- 4.3" Full-color LCD touchscreen display
- Easy-to-use DAW-inspired interface
- Record up to 16 tracks (8 simultaneously)
- Eight XLR mic preamps, including two mic/line/instrument combo jacks
- Hi-Z available on input 1 and 48V phantom power available on inputs 5-8
- Color-coded volume faders, gain knobs and tracks
- Onboard editing and built-in effects
- Pre-loaded drum loops
- Optional BTA-1 Bluetooth enables wireless control via the R20 Control App
- USB-C audio interface up to 8-in / 4-out
- Records directly to SDHC cards up to 32GB and SDXC cards up to 1TB
- Locking-type AC adapter (ZAD-1220)
- Up to 24-bit /44.1 kHz audio in BWF-compliant WAV
- Compatible with Guitar Lab software for Mac/Windows PC

"Missing basic functions"

Overall: 2.5 out of 5 stars
(see rating details)
Verified Customer zZounds has verified that this reviewer made a purchase from us.
I received the unit a few days ago and I‘m surprised that it doesn’t have a “punch-in/out” function. I don’t know of any other digital multitrack recorder that lacks this function. It also doesn’t have a “repeat” function - another very useful feature that is popular with other recorders. The touch screen is a bit “jerky” and usually takes me a few extra “taps” or “drags” to achieve the desired result. The screen itself is bright and clear although any vertical scrolling is hard to follow because of the poor screen refresh rate. The iOS controller app might help here but it’s not available yet and there is no release date (early 2022 says the manual). It has some helpful features - drum track templates with prerecorded drum parts are nice but I would gladly trade them for the basic functions I mentioned earlier. One last thing - only 2 of the 8 inputs accept 1/4 inch cable. All other recorders in this price range allow 1/4 inch for any of the tracks.
